Defendant was convicted of criminal sexual assault. Jury could reasonably draw inferences that prosecutor argued: that Defendant was apologizing for his sexual misconduct with 15-year-old friend of his son, by making apologies to victim, her mother, and the police, and that such apologies were "evidence of a guilty man". Court is required to conduct a hearing into a defendant's financial resources as a precondition to ordering reimbursement for court-appointed counsel. (APPLETON and POPE, concurring.)
